Serene backwaters invite peaceful boat rides past coconut groves and traditional villages in this tranquil Kerala town. Visit the historic Ambalapuzha Sri Krishna Temple nearby for its stunning architecture and famous 'palpayasam' sweet offering.

What's the seasonal weather in Kalavoor?
The hottest months are usually March and April, with an average temperature of 28°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 27°C. The rainiest months in Kalavoor are June, July, August and May, with each month seeing an average of 402 mm of rainfall.
